Resin kit by Starter in 1/43rd scale.   I built it straight out of the box with just the addition of the metal antenna, and I made the decals.  I also made the vinyl top by brush painting/texturing it with acrylic black.  The windows were sun-bleached to minimize the yellowing due to age.

2 hours ago, Monty said:

Question: are you basically using stippling to create the vinyl roof texture? 

Yes, once the paint is starting set a light stippling.  But don't do too much or it will lift the paint right off.
